I'm looking to set up shared folders to use as discussion boards, as well as possibly to use the new NNTP functionality to mirror some newsgroups into shared folders.
However, that pretty much dictates using an MUA that supports "direct posting" of messages into those folders, rather than requiring them to be sent into the folders via SMTP (at least that's the way it seems to me). Anyone have any suggestions? I'd like it very much if I could get SquirrelMail to do this, but I'd like to try out any other alternatives to see if this technique is going to work.
Are you worrying about how user's reading newsgroups via IMAP shared folders will post to these groups? If so, you can allow this fairly easily by using the newspostuser option and the lmtp2nntp software. Take a look at doc/install-netnews.html for details on how to set this up.
